Classification of Materials

Ormesby The first step in determining the cost of a steel structure is to classify the materials used. There are several categories of steel materials that can be used in construction projects, including structural steel, reinforcing steel, and non-structural steel. Each category has its own set of properties and characteristics that affect the cost of materials.

Structural steel is the most common type of steel used in construction projects. It is characterized by its high strength and ductility, making it ideal for use in buildings, bridges, and other large-scale structures. Reinforcing steel, on the other hand, is used to reinforce concrete or other materials and is typically lighter in weight than structural steel. Non-structural steel is used for items such as railings, fences, and decorative elements.

Unit Prices

Once the materials have been classified, the next step is to determine their unit prices. Unit prices are based on the weight or volume of the material, as well as any additional factors such as delivery charges and taxes. For example, if a client requests 100 tons of structural steel, the unit price would be determined based on the weight of the material and any applicable fees.

Labor rates are another critical component of steel structure billing rules. Labor rates are based on the skill level and experience of the contractor, as well as the complexity of the project. Some common types of labor include welding, cutting, drilling, and assembly. Labor rates vary depending on the type of work being performed, as well as the size and scope of the project.
